Welcome to the Quillbase on-call rotation. Heads up: dark-mode support shipped last week in the Ledgerpane admin dashboard. It's CSS-only; no new endpoints, no auth changes. The theme toggle persists in local storage, nothing server-side. Known issue: contrast warnings on the audit table flagged by the accessibility scan — fix pending. Review notes and the threat-model addendum for the change are on the internal page below.

dashboard of yafog-fajof = https://jira.tolvaqsys.internal/pages/pages/projects/49fe21c4

Ticket — Missed pick-up, recalled charger pallet

For the receiving site at Norlake Depot: yesterday's scheduled collection of the recalled Ampeline charger pallet did not occur; the courier from Traverso Freight never arrived. The pallet remains sealed in the quarantine cage, recall tags intact and manifest attached. A replacement pick-up is booked for tomorrow morning. The confidential courier hand-over instruction is noted below.

handover note for yagef-bagep: the drudor pelius courier leaves the kasdor zorvan norir ledger at gate 8016 under passcode 755406

## Auth for GateTally

GateTally counts turnstile spins at Bramblefield Stadium and pushes totals to the ops dashboard every 30 seconds. If you're on call and the counts flatline, it's almost always an auth problem, not broken hardware — the turnstiles are weirdly reliable. GateTally authenticates against the internal Crowdline service with a static key passed in a header. Yes, we know, rotation is on the roadmap. For now, restart the collector with the key shown below.

service key, tadup-tahog: zpat7_wB1tnEL

**Ticket TRC-412: TileForge cache vault locked after failover**

Hey — during last night's failover the Quimberton region's tile-cache vault auto-sealed and nobody can rotate the render keys. Cache hit rate is tanking. Per our break-glass procedure, the unseal phrase gets documented here for your sign-off before we use it. The recovery passphrase is as follows.

unlock words, fafop-hawep: briwyn-oliix-sorox